What we don't see is the pattern of the situation the previous couple of miles or so. Was the driver of the red car looking impatient and like he might want to pass, too? Was there any indication to the rider that the criver might make a move? If so, I'd have held back until he did so. In this video, I got the impression that was the case, so I wouldn't have passed until the car had done so. Plus the cars were so close together he'd have had to pass two - always a little riskier than just passing one. True, the driver can be accused of not looking before he made his move, but equally the rider was maybe pushing his luck a bit.
